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ce Ingredients

For the Pork
Pork Tenderloin Aim for 1.2 lbs (≈550 g) for optimum juiciness.
Salt Season generously to enhance overall flavor.
Freshly Ground Black Pepper Adds warmth and a subtle heat to the dish.
Olive Oil Used for searing, creating a beautiful golden crust.

For the Sauce
Garlic Minced for aromatic infusion into the sauce.
Shallot Finely chopped to add a touch of subtle sweetness.
Chicken Broth ½ cup, perfect for deglazing and developing rich flavors.
Heavy Cream Provides the luscious, creamy texture the sauce needs.
Dijon Mustard The key ingredient for that distinctive tangy flavor that sets this dish apart.
Fresh Thyme Leaves 1 tsp for a hint of herbal notes; alternative: ½ tsp dried thyme.

How to Make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ce

  1. Prepare: Pat the pork tenderloin dry with paper towels. Generously season it with salt and freshly ground black pepper to enhance the flavor profile beautifully.

  2. Sear: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the pork and sear on all sides until golden brown, about 3-4 minutes per side. Once seared, remove and set aside.

  3. Sauté Aromatics: In the same skillet, add the minced garlic and chopped shallot.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ant, letting those yummy flavors infuse the oil.

  4. Deglaze: Pour in the chicken broth, scraping up any tasty browned bits from the skillet. Let it simmer for 2-3 minutes to build a rich base for the sauce.

  5. Make Sauce: Reduce the heat to low, then stir in the heavy cream, Dijon mustard, and thyme. Simmer for about 3-4 minutes until the sauce thickens up perfectly.

  6. Simmer Together: Return the seared pork to the skillet, spooning sauce over it. Simmer for another 5-7 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 145°F (63°C), ensuring it s cook to juicy perfection.

  7. Serve: Slice the pork, pour that creamy sauce over the top, and garnish with fresh parsley for a lovely finishing touch.

Optional: Drizzle with a little extra Dijon for a zesty kick.

How to Store and Freeze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ce

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Keep the sauce separate to maintain pork tenderness and sauce creaminess.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the pork tenderloin and sauce in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.

Reheating: Reheat gently on the stovetop over low heat, adding a splash of chicken broth or cream to restore the sauce’s silky texture. Avoid boiling to prevent curdling.

Refrigerate Quickly: Make sure to cool and refrigerate any leftovers within two hours of cooking to ensure food safety and preserve flavor in your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ce.

Make Ahead Options

Preparing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ce ahead of time makes weeknight dinners a breeze! You can season the pork and even sear it up to 24 hours in advance, allowing the flavors to enhance. Simply store the seared pork in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The sauce can also be made and refrigerated for up to 3 days; just remember to reheat it gently to preserve its creamy texture. When ready to serve, reheat the pork and spoon the warmed sauce over it, simmering until heated through to enjoy that delicious, restaurant-quality flavor with minimal fuss. Expert Tips for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ce

  • Searing Technique: Ensure the skillet is hot before adding the pork; a proper sear locks in juiciness and creates a beautiful crust.

  • Use a Thermometer: Check the internal temperature with a meat thermometer, aiming for 145°F (63°C). This guarantees perfectly cooked pork tenderloin.

  • Stir Carefully: When adding heavy cream, stir constantly to prevent curdling; this keeps your sauce smooth and creamy for the Pork Tenderloin with Dijon Mustard Cream Sauce.

  • Garnish with Freshness: Don t skip the fresh parsley garnish; it adds a pop of color and a hint of freshness that elevates the dish visually and flavor-wise.

  • Avoid Overcrowding: If your skillet isn’t large enough, sear the pork in batches. Overcrowding can cause steaming instead of the desired browning.

What if my pork tenderloin is tough after cooking?
Very! If the pork tenderloin turns out tough, it may be due to overcooking or not letting it rest after searing. Always use a meat thermometer to ensure it reaches an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) for optimal juiciness. To remedy any toughness, slice it thinly against the grain and serve it with plenty of sauce to enhance the texture.
